Spalling is the term used to describe the pitting and damaging that fire triggers to block, block, and concrete. It's an indicator that the concrete has actually lost toughness, and is caused by warm expanding the concrete one way while the mass of the wall surface draws it the other. What is the Celebration Wall Surface Act 3 Metre guideline?
What is the Event Wall Act 3 metre rule? The Party Wall act covers excavations within 3 metres of an Adjacent Owner, if the most affordable factor of the excavation will be less than the underside of the footings to the celebration wall (or components of their residential or commercial property which are within 3 metres of the suggested excavation).
